What the Data Says About Annaleigh
The Social Security Administration has registered 2,756 babies named Annaleigh between 1985 and 2024, spanning 40 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Annaleigh currently holds the #1984 rank among girls for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 2014, when 195 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Annaleigh performed strongest in the 2010s, accumulating 1,648 births during that ten-year window. Across the 5 decades of recorded activity, Annaleigh shows a clear decline from its mid-century high.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in Texas, which accounts for 200 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Georgia and Tennessee. In total, SSA state-level files list Annaleigh in 26 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 2,756 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
